Description

Sandton Hotel de Filosoof Amsterdam is one of the most inspiring and unique hotels in Amsterdam. It is established in a few historic buildings at just a stone's throw away from the Vondelpark. All rooms are decorated in an exclusive style that refer to a certain philosopher or philosophical theme.

This hotel is beautifully located in quiet surroundings on the edge of the Vondelpark. While it is ideal for relaxation, you can also take a stroll through the park to the Leidseplein or one of the renowned museums. The sophisticated shopping street P.C. Hooftstraat and the Concertgebouw are within close range as well. Because everybody is different on the outside as well as the inside, all 38 rooms in this hotel are decorated in different styles referring to a certain philosopher or philosophical theme, for example there is a Confucius, Nietzsche and Spinoza room. The staff at the reception will do their utmost to honour your preference, depending on availability.

This unique hotel is equipped with two multifunctional rooms for 2 to 30 people where you can have a private or business meeting in an exceptional atmosphere. You can choose from several catering arrangements to complement your meeting. Leisure guests can relax in the beautiful garden, the cosy bar/lobby or library. Though all rooms are furnished differently, they are all equipped with a private bathroom, television and telephone.

Surroundings

The Sandton Hotel de Filosoof Amsterdam is situated in a quiet neighbourhood next to the Vondelpark. This park is over 140 years old and very popular with Amsterdam residents as well as tourists. Every year no less than ten million people visit the park. This is even more than Central Park in New York, if converted to square meters!
